postpone
英 /pəˈspəʊn/美 /poʊˈspoʊn/
基本释义
- v.推迟,延缓;把……放在次要地位;把……放在后面
第三人称单数postpones
现在分词postponing
过去式postponed
过去分词postponed

词语例句
推迟,延缓vt.
He decided to postpone the expedition until the following day.
他决定将探险活动推迟到第二天。
If the meal must be postponed for more than an hour, a snack helps to avoid a hunger headache.
如果吃饭必须推迟一个多小时,那么吃点零食有助于避免饥饿引起的头痛。
Eric told me that they postponed having children until he gets his doctoral degree.
埃里克告诉我,直到他拿到博士学位后他们才会要孩子。
把……放在次要地位vt.
He is a selfless person who always postpones private ambitions to the public welfare.
他是个无私的人,总是把公众福利看得比个人抱负更重要。
把……放在后面vt.
In this sentence, the adjective is postponed.
在这句话里,形容词被后置了。
- I, for one, would prefer to postpone the meeting.主张推迟会期的,我就是一个。来自《牛津词典》
- It was an unpopular decision to postpone building the new hospital.延迟兴建新医院的决定是不得人心的。来自《牛津词典》
- It is totally out of the question to postpone the midnight deadline.延迟午夜的最后期限是根本不可能的。来自《柯林斯英汉双解大词典》

词源
- postpone推迟,使延期词根词缀: post-后 + -pon-放置 + -e → 把事情向后方
- postpone推迟,延期post-,在后,-pon,放置,词源同position.引申词义推迟,延期。
- postponeFrom Latin postpono (“I put after; I postpone”) from Latin post (“after”) + pono (“I put; I place”), compare forestall.
